Condor Tri-rail question.

Does anyone make a Condor sized tri-rail scope mount for the full length of the Condor scope rail? I have the one made for the Talon, but it is a bit short on the Condor as you know. Seems like this would help strengthen a weak spot in the frame. Just a thought.

The point you made makes a lot of sense to me. From what I understand, it’s always better to keep the scope as close to the barrel as possible for long range accuracy. I read on here somwhere that the top rail where the scope mounts is flimsy to some degree and there is frame flex when the gun is gripped too hard which causes POI issues.

This is why I asked about a full length tri-rail option. Seems like it still may be worth it if this is true and granted the scope isn’t affected by being mounted too high. Maybe a tri-rail and some short scope rings would do the trick. ??? Sometimes one has to choose the lesser of two evils and I’m not sure if this is a case for this or not. Better off getting either an E-tac to lower the bottle a bit or TT’s new fangled bottle lowering thing. Use Woks Trigger guard thingy to strengthen the frame at that weak area. Best not to put any metal between the frame and your scope. The Tri-rail at best is mediocre quality…
